Raybestos Adds 428 New Part Numbers To Line Of Brake Components

The addition includes brake hoses, brake rotors, brake calipers and accessories, brake cables, clutch hoses and brake pad sets.

Raybestos has expanded its line of premium-quality brake products with the addition of 428 new part numbers this month.

The new part numbers include:

  • Brake hoses – 86
  • Brake rotors – 88
  • Brake calipers – 70
  • Brake caliper assemblies – 140
  • Brake cables – 28
  • Clutch hoses – 10
  • Brake pad sets – 6

“As a dedicated top-quality brake supplier, we are continuously adding new part numbers to our line of Raybestos premium-quality brake products to help our customers grow their brake businesses,” said Kristin Grons, marketing manager, Brake Parts Inc. “This month alone we’ve added part numbers across all product categories to ensure our customers have optimal coverage.”
